When Tour Groups Make Sense
There are very few instances where I will take a tour group ahead of setting out on my own. This isn’t to say tours are necessarily bad or that nobody should ever take one, but more so that they just aren’t for me. I like to walk to the beat of my own drum and see what the world has in store around the routes less travelled – you don’t often get that in a tour group. New York – The City That Has it All
New York City is a place that everyone needs to visit at least once in their life, if for no other reason than to see what all the fuss is about. It’s a locale that has been the star of more major films and television shows than almost any actor and even if you’ve never been there, it will feel immediately recognizable. From the Empire State Building to that Statue of Liberty and Times Square – these are the destinations many people equate with New York and even the United States of America as a whole and they shouldn’t be missed. A Food Lover’s Guide To Jamaica
Jamaica is internationally known for its rhythmic music, lovely beaches, and historic sugar plantations. However, the distinctive flavours of its food are unmistakable and sometimes overlooked when people consider the popular holiday destination.
